WebChinese New Year is a time when families get together to celebrate and they gather for reunion dinners on New Year's Eve. Houses are cleaned from top to bottom; the aim is to sweep out any bad luck from the old year and clear the way for good luck. Doors are decorated with narrow red paper strips called couplets which symbolise good fortune ...

WebJan 9, 2024 · 24th day of 12th lunar month (Jan. 15, 2024) - House Cleaning. According to the traditional schedule of Chinese New Year preparation, cleaning is done on this day. All vessels, curtains, beddings and every corner need to be cleaned, and people hope to welcome the festival in a clean environment. See more WebOct 29, 2024 · Chinese New Year is a widely celebrated holiday in many parts of the world. In fact, according to recent estimates, over 1.5 billion people in over 30 countries observe the holiday. Asia is home to the majority of countries that celebrate Chinese New Year, though a few countries in Europe and the Americas also mark the occasion.
